차이점 설명RestTemplate: exchange() vs postForEntity() vs execute()참조 : https://stackoverflow.com/questions/52364187/resttemplate-exchange-vs-postforentity-vs-execute 각 기능별 예시및 설명참조 : https://stackoverflow.com/questions/10358345/making-authenticated-post-requests-with-spring-resttemplate-for-android참조 : https://stackoverflow.com/questions/4075991/post-request-via-resttemplate-in-json/27106518참조 : htt..
* 오라클 계정에서 sysdba 권한으로 로그인 sqlplus / as sysdba * 암호화 패키지 추가 @$ORACLE_HOME/rdbms/admin/dbmsobtk.sql @$ORACLE_HOME/rdbms/admin/prvtobtk.plb * 암호화 패키지 사용권한 추가 grant execute on dbms_crypto to public; grant execute on dbms_obfuscation_toolkit to public; * 사용자 계정으로 로그인 하여 패키지 생성CREATE OR REPLACE PACKAGE pkg_crypto IS FUNCTION encrypt ( input_string IN VARCHAR2 , key_data IN VARCHAR2 := '12345678' ) RE..
기존에 사용하던 시스템에서 신규 생성된 시스템으로 DB 를 이전할 일이 발생하여 이전작업을 진행하다 기존의 방식과는 다른 방식으로 접근해야 하는 경우가 생겨 블로그에 남겨놓는다. 일반적인 복원 시에는 동일한 테이블스페이스 (이하 TS) 를 생성 후 데이터 파일에 MAXSIZE unlimited 옵션을 줄 경우 문제없이 이용이 가능 했지만, 복원하려는 백업본이 30G 를 넘어서게 되면 하나의 TS 파일 가지고는 복원을 진행할 수 없다 1. 일반적인 복원시 TS 파일 생성 예. CREATE TABLESPACE MINOV DATAFILE '/oracle/oradata/MINOV/MINOV_01.DBF' SIZE 1G AUTOEXTEND ON NEXT 1G MAXSIZE unlimited PERMANENT ON..
이번에 쓸 내용은 MySQL (실제 설치한 DB는 MariaDB) 설치시 ERROR 2002 (HY000) 문제가 발생하여 해당 방법을 해결하기 위해 찾았던 방법을 설명하고자 한다.MariaDB 는 MySQL 이 Sun 에서 Oracle 로 인수되면서 오픈소스 정책은 유지하지만, Oracle 자체가 Oracle 이라는 대형 DBMS 를 소유한 업체이기 때문에 어떤 라이센스 정책을 유지할지 모르는 상황으로 인해 기존 MySQL 개발자들이 소스코드를 그대로 하여 MariaDB 를 만들었으며보편적으로 대부분의 기능이 동일하다. 설치법 또한 기존의 MySQL 과 동일하나 INNODB 등의 쓰임세 등이 더 세부화 되어 있다는 게 특징이다.각설하고, 본론으도 들어가서, 정상적으로 YUM 설치가 아닌 CONFIGUR..
IIS 7.X 기반에서 운영중인 서버에 파일 서버와 연결해 놓고 IIS 에 가상디렉토리를 설정하여 사용하던중, 작업자가 파일서버 올린 파일 중 하나의 파일명이 공백을 포함하고 있어 파일 다운로드시 파일명 뒤 공백영역이 URI Encoding 되어 + 로 표기되면서 파일이 다운로드 되지 않고 404 페이지 에러가 발생하였다. 메일에 포함되어 발송된 부분이라 파일명을 변경할 수는 없는지라, 방법을 찾아보던중 하단의 방법들을 찾을 수 있었다. 우선 서버에 적용했던 방법은 하단의 방법으로 "Default Web ~" 적용하고자 하는 IIS 명칭 으로 변경하고 Administrator 권한으로 commend 처리를 하니, 문제없이 파일이 보여졌다. %windir%\system32\inetsrv\appcmd set..
참조 : https://developers.facebook.com/docs/guides/appcenter/#authorization 참조 : https://developers.facebook.com/docs/reference/login/ 참조 : https://developers.facebook.com/docs/reference/javascript/FB.api/ window.fbAsyncInit = function() { FB.init({ appId : 'app_id', // App ID status : true, // check login status cookie : true // enable cookies to allow the server to access the session }); // Chec..
우연찮게 크로스 도메인 과 타 도메인에서 AJAX 로 값을 주고받을 일이 있었다, 그런데 계속 0 에러를 발생하길레, 곰곰히 생각해 보니 예전에 얼핏 타 도메인에서는 기존의 AJAX 호출로는 값을 주고 받을 수 없다는 것이 기억나서 해당 부분을 찾아 보았다. function demo(data1, data2, data3){ var remoteAddr = ""; if(File != "" && Gubun != "" && Title != ""){ $.getJSON("http://도메인/파일명?callbak=?",{data1:escape(data1),data2:escape(data2),data3:escape(data3)},function(data) { if(data.result == "SUCC"){ result ..
"Flds.Item(schema & "sendemailaddress") = "홍길동 "Flds.Item(schema & "smtpuserreplyemailaddress") = "홍길동 "Flds.Item(schema & "smtpserver") = "smtp.gmail.com" Flds.Item(schema & "smtpserverport") = 465Flds.Item(schema & "smtpauthenticate") = 1Flds.Item(schema & "sendusername") = "홍길동@gmail.com"Flds.Item(schema & "sendpassword") = "메일암호"Flds.Item(schema & "smtpusessl") = 1Flds.UpdateSet Flds = Nothi..
JSP 에서 관리자 및 특정 사용자에게만 공개를 위해 IP 대역을 확인 하여 페이지 Redirection 처리를 위해 아래의 코드를 사용. String RemoteAddr = ""; String ClientIP = request.getHeader("WL-Proxy-Client-IP"); String gotoURL = "redirect url"; if(!request.getRemoteAddr().equals("") || !request.getRemoteAddr().equals(null)){ RemoteAddr = request.getRemoteAddr(); }else{ RemoteAddr = request.getHeader("WL-Proxy-Client-IP"); } int AdminAddrYN = 0; ..
Win32 계열 Apache Tomcat 5.5 에 구동중인 JSP 사이트에 HTTPS 를 사용하기 위해 SSL 인증서를 붙이는 작업을 진행 하였는데, 작업 중 에러가 발생하여 이것저것 참고 하다 아래의 결론을 도출 원할하게 사용중이다. 서버 구성사항 1. OS : Windows Server 2003 2. WAS : Apache Tomcat 5.5 3. Language : JSP 1. JAVA keytool 을 이용한 요청키 생성 우선 JDK, JRE 둘 중 하나가 설치된 폴더로 접근한다. (가급적이면 현재 Tomcat 사용 path 로) 이동 후 /* CN, OU, O, L, ST, C 등은 임의적으로 사용해도 되나, 업체별로 지정해 놓은 경우도 있기 때문에, 인증서 발급 업체에서 지정하는 형식이 있으..
- Total
- Today
- Yesterday
- postForObject
- CKEditor
- HTTPD
- Entity Code
- 파일명 공백
- 1차원 배열저장
- 엔티티 코드표
- resttemplate
- 구분자 자르기
- iis 파일 다운로드 공백
- selinux
- 정규식
- CKFinder
- php
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| 7 |
8 | 9 | 10 | 11 | 12 | 13 | 14 |
15 | 16 | 17 | 18 | 19 | 20 | 21 |
22 | 23 | 24 | 25 | 26 | 27 | 28 |
29 | 30 | 31 |